==Service== The combined East London and South London line service is described by Transport for London as the Highbury & Islington to New Cross, Clapham Junction, Crystal Palace and West Croydon route.<ref name="Dec 23 times">{{cite web |title=Highbury & Islington to New Cross, Clapham Junction, Crystal Palace and West Croydon route |url=https://content.tfl.gov.uk/highbury-and-islington-to-west-croydon-london-overground-timetable-dec-to-june-2024.pdf |website=Transport for London |access-date=16 February 2024}}</ref> As of the December 2023 timetable the typical off-peak service pattern is:<ref name="Dec 23 times"/> {| class="wikitable" ! Route !! tph !! Calling at |- | {{stnlnk|Dalston Junction}} to {{stnlnk|New Cross}} || 4 || {{cslist|{{stnlnk|Haggerston}}|{{stnlnk|Hoxton}}|{{stnlnk|Shoreditch High Street}}|{{station|Whitechapel}}|{{stnlink|Shadwell}}|{{stnlnk|Wapping}}|{{stnlnk|Rotherhithe}}|{{station|Canada Water}}|{{stnlnk|Surrey Quays}}}} |- | Dalston Junction to {{stnlnk|Clapham Junction}} || 4 || {{cslist|Haggerston|Hoxton|Shoreditch High Street|Whitechapel|Shadwell|Wapping|Rotherhithe|Canada Water|Surrey Quays|{{stnlnk|Queens Road Peckham}}|{{stnlnk|Peckham Rye}}|{{stnlnk|Denmark Hill}}|{{stnlnk|Clapham High Street}}|{{stnlnk|Wandsworth Road}}}} |- | {{station|Highbury & Islington}} to {{rws|Crystal Palace}} || 4 || {{cslist|{{rws|Canonbury}}|Dalston Junction|Haggerston|Hoxton|Shoreditch High Street|Whitechapel|Shadwell|Wapping|Rotherhithe|Canada Water|Surrey Quays|{{rws|New Cross Gate}}|{{rws|Brockley}}|{{rws|Honor Oak Park}}|{{rws|Forest Hill}}|{{rws|Sydenham|London}}}} |- | Highbury & Islington to {{station|West Croydon}} || 4 || {{cslist|Canonbury|Dalston Junction|Haggerston|Hoxton|Shoreditch High Street, Whitechapel|Shadwell|Wapping|Rotherhithe|Canada Water|Surrey Quays|New Cross Gate|Brockley|Honor Oak Park|Forest Hill|Sydenham|{{rws|Penge West}}|{{rws|Anerley}}|{{rws|Norwood Junction}}}} |} A Friday and Saturday [[Night Tube|night service]] was introduced between Dalston Junction and New Cross Gate (initially not stopping at Whitechapel) from December 2017. ===Renaming=== In July 2023, TfL announced that it would be giving each of the six Overground services unique names by the end of the following year.<ref>{{Cite web |last= |first= |title=Naming London Overground lines |url=https://www.tfl.gov.uk/travel-information/improvements-and-projects/naming-overground |access-date=2024-02-11 |website=Transport for London }}</ref><ref>{{Cite news |date=2023-07-01 |title=London Overground lines to be given names |url=https://www.bbc.com/news/uk-england-london-66067924 |access-date=2024-02-11 |work=[[BBC News]] }}</ref> In February 2024, it was confirmed that the service running on the East London and [[South London line|South London]] lines would be named the ''Windrush line'' (to honour the [[Windrush generation]] of immigrants to the area from the Caribbean) and would be coloured red on the updated network map.<ref>[https://www.bbc.co.uk/news/uk-england-london-68296483 London Overground: New names for its six lines revealed], BBC News, 15 February 2024</ref>
